Application of glass ionomer cements by the professionals of Belém-PA

Objectives:The aim of this paper was to evaluate the degree of knowledge and difficulties related to the application of glass ionomer cements (GIC) on the clinical practice of dentists who act in the metropolitan area of Belém - PA. Methods: Forty-two professionals were randomized from 168 registered at the Regional Concil of Dentistry - Section of Pará, at the specialties of pedodontics and restorative dentistry, representing 25% of the total. For data collection it was used a form composed by 18 questions about indications, properties, cares with manipulation and insertion of GIC. Results: The descriptive analysis of the results has made evident the need for a large knowledge by the professionals, as 51% did not know that GIC has got a thermic coefficient of expansion similar to the tooth and 11% were not aware about biocompatibility of such material. Whilst 87% of the professionals applied GIC at their dentistry clinics, 59% did not use it to occlusal seal,38% did not use such material as a base or lining for restorations with composite resisn and 24% did not use it as a provisional restorative material. The greatest mentioned limitations of the professionals were unsatisfatory mechanical toughness (27%), high cost (24%), difficulty of insertion (23%)and a long setting time (21%). Conclusions:It was concluded that, despite the great acceptance of the material evidenced in the research, the professionals do not present a profound knowledge about glass ionomer cements and do need more information about such material.
